Total pulse consumption rose 150% to 15,000 kt in Libya in 2021, according to Faostat.

Historically, total pulse consumption in Libya reached an all time high of 20,000 kt in 2018 and an all time low of 3,000 kt in 2010. When compared to Libya's main peers, total pulse consumption in Algeria amounted to 199,000 kt, 40,000 kt in Chad, 342,000 kt in Egypt and 81,000 kt in Tunisia in 2021.

Libya has been ranked 87th within the group of 144 countries we follow in terms of total pulse consumption, 14 places above the position seen 10 years ago.
